Dáil Éireann Debate, Tuesday - 14 November 2023

Tuesday, 14 November 2023

Questions (190)

Neasa Hourigan

Question:

190. Deputy Neasa Hourigan asked the Minister for Education her plans to ensure all schools in the State have access to drinking water for students; and if she will make a statement on the matter. [49389/23]

View answer

Written answers

In relation to new school buildings and extensions my Department provides a tap drinking water system as a matter of routine.

In existing buildings if a school has concerns about the quality of its drinking water, the matter can be addressed by the relevant local authority and Irish Water. If any quality issues are identified as a result of a test, my Department provides funding to address the issue.

If a school does not have a tap drinking water supply, my Department will provide funding to address the issue.

The relevant funding mechanisms are the minor works grant for small-scale works or the Summer Works Scheme or, if appropriate, the Emergency Works Scheme, for larger scale works.
